Job Description

Stantec is seeking a safety-focused leader with construction field experience to oversee construction quality control (QA/QC) on a mine remediation project near Spokane, Washington. This person will work onsite daily, directing a team that verifies that construction meets design specifications while working alongside the client and various contractors. This is a full-time onsite role. Qualified candidates will have relevant field experience and a degree in engineering or geology; an associate’s degree with strong surveying skills; a professional surveying license; or comparable, relevant work experience meeting job requirements. These roles include leadership, daily interaction with the client, and seeing years of geotechnical engineering and mine reclamation design implemented. Work shift is 4 days per week working 10‑hour shifts plus a one‑hour drive each way for a total of 48 hours per week.

Specific activities to be performed by the applicant include:

  • Creating and maintaining a high‑functioning safety culture, tracking compliance with safe work practices and adhering to company and client guidelines and policies for planning and executing work in a safe manner. OSHA HAZWOPER and supervisor training will be required.
  • Use of and mastery of an array of field equipment, including Trimble survey equipment, portable X‑ray fluorescence spectrometer, and electronic density gauge.
  • Contributing to design solutions, as‑built construction records, and other field engineering activities utilizing AutoCAD Civil3D and Trimble Business Center software.
  • Planning, coordinating, directing, and executing Stantec QA/QC field team activities and documentation, including field observations, sample collection, field testing (as required), and daily field reports.
  • Reviewing and responding to technical memoranda, requests for information (RFIs), as well as detailed as‑built reports pertaining to the project construction activities.
  • Providing supervision and direction for various QA/QC activities including sample collection, gradation analyses, material density testing, and surveying.
  • Interacting daily with client management, engineering, and field staff to plan and execute field engineering and CQA activities
